Dear mentors,

I am looking for a sponsor for my package "python-jellyfish"

* Package name    : python-jellyfish
  Version         : 0.5.1-1
  Upstream Author : James Turk <james.p.turk@gmail.com>
* URL             : https://github.com/jamesturk/jellyfish
* License         : BSD-2-clause
  Section         : python

It builds those binary packages:

python-jellyfish - Library for approximate and phonetic matching of strings (Python 2)
python-jellyfish-doc - Library for approximate and phonetic matching of strings (documentation)
python3-jellyfish - Library for approximate and phonetic matching of strings (Python 3)
